Legal fees for immigration cases vary based on the specific type of application you are filing. Generally, a straightforward visa renewal or document update costs less than complex proceedings like deportation defense or permanent residency petitions involving multiple family members. The total time a lawyer spends gathering evidence, drafting declarations, and attending interviews also influences the final bill. Visa bonds, or immigration bonds, are primarily used in removal proceedings. They allow individuals to be released from detention while their case is pending, provided they post a financial bond. The Immigration and Protection Tribunal (IPT) is an independent body that reviews decisions made by immigration officials or lower courts in certain countries. Its role is to ensure that immigration and protection decisions are fair and consistent with the law. It handles appeals and reviews of various immigration matters.
